目录
引言
在数字化时代,AI声音模仿技术越来越受到关注。它能够模拟人类的声音,并广泛应用于多个领域,如娱乐、教育和客服等。而在这个过程中,GitHub作为开源代码托管平台,提供了许多优秀的项目和资源,助力开发者和研究者进行声音模仿的探索和实践。
AI声音模仿的定义
AI声音模仿是指利用人工智能技术,通过机器学习和深度学习模型,生成与人类声音相似的音频。这个过程通常涉及以下几个步骤:
- 数据采集
- 模型训练
- 声音合成
AI声音模仿技术可以生成高质量的声音效果,甚至能够模拟特定个体的语音特征。
为什么选择GitHub进行AI声音模仿
选择GitHub作为AI声音模仿项目的基础有以下几个原因:
- 开放性:GitHub允许任何人查看和贡献代码,促进了技术共享与合作。
- 社区支持:大量开发者在GitHub上交流,能够获取丰富的经验和技术支持。
- 文档齐全:很多项目都有详细的文档和使用示例,便于初学者学习。
热门的AI声音模仿GitHub项目
在GitHub上,有很多优秀的AI声音模仿项目。以下是一些推荐的项目:
1. Tacotron 2
Tacotron 2是一个基于神经网络的文本到语音(TTS)合成模型。它能够生成自然流畅的语音,并具有较高的可控性。其特点包括:
- 采用字符级的文本表示,能更好地处理不同语言。
- 与WaveNet结合使用,提升了声音合成的质量。
2. WaveNet
WaveNet是一个由DeepMind开发的深度神经网络模型,专注于音频生成。它的优势在于:
- 能够合成高保真的语音。
- 生成的声音更加真实,且具有情感色彩。
3. VoiceCloning
VoiceCloning项目允许用户通过少量的音频数据进行声音模仿。这个项目的特点有:
- 支持多种语言。
- 适用于短时间内制作高质量的语音合成。
如何使用这些AI声音模仿工具
使用这些AI声音模仿工具一般包括以下步骤:
- 安装依赖:根据项目文档,安装所需的库和依赖。
- 准备数据:收集需要的音频数据,通常包括文本和对应的音频文件。
- 训练模型:根据项目说明,配置参数并进行模型训练。
- 生成声音:使用训练好的模型生成目标音频。
AI声音模仿的应用场景
AI声音模仿的应用场景非常广泛,主要包括:
- 娱乐:电影配音、游戏角色的语音生成。
- 教育:个性化学习助手,提供语音教学服务。
- 客服:自动化语音应答系统,提高客户服务效率。
- 无障碍服务:帮助听障人士通过合成语音进行交流。
常见问题解答
1. AI声音模仿需要哪些技术基础?
要进行AI声音模仿,一般需要掌握以下技术基础:
- 深度学习和机器学习的基本概念。
- 熟悉Python编程语言。
- 了解信号处理与音频合成相关知识。
2. 如何选择合适的AI声音模仿工具?
选择工具时可以考虑以下几点:
- 目标需求:你需要生成什么样的声音?
- 技术支持:是否有良好的文档和社区支持?
- 使用难度:根据自己的技术水平选择合适的工具。
3. AI声音模仿的合成声音能达到什么程度?
当前的AI声音模仿技术已经可以生成相当逼真的声音,能够模拟特定个体的语音特征和情感色彩。但是,具体的质量还依赖于所用的数据集和模型。
总结
AI声音模仿作为一个前沿技术,正在不断发展。通过使用GitHub上的优秀项目,开发者和研究者可以更方便地探索和实现这一技术。无论是对技术的研究,还是实际的应用,这些资源都为我们提供了广阔的空间。希望本文能帮助大家更好地理解和应用AI声音模仿技术。
正文完